## Quartzline Environments: Hermetic Build Migration

Hey folks — we're moving the Quartzline render service from the old Patchwork builds to Kilnbox, our hermetic build system. Short version: no more network fetches at build time, everything is pinned. Staging already builds this way; prod flips next sprint. The Kilnbox settings staging currently uses are listed below.

deployment values, kajep-kageg:
[praix]
host = praix.paliqcorp.corp
user = praix_svc
database = praix_prod

CI note: the StageGrid seat-map renderer fails snapshot tests only on the arm64 runners. Cause is a font-metrics difference that shifts balcony row labels by one pixel. Not a product bug. I've pinned the renderer image to the amd64 baseline until we regenerate snapshots per-arch. Reviewer: please confirm the pin matches the image referenced below.

session token of kageg-kajep = htk31_8e387f741d208554faee18934428597

## Audio stream returns 403 on exhibit pages

The Wrenhaven audio-guide app signs each stream request with a short-lived bearer token minted at session start. A 403 typically indicates the token expired mid-tour; the client should silently refresh. Reviewers can inspect the token minting flow in the sandbox environment. To exercise the sandbox minting endpoint directly, use the token below.

portal login ticket: eyJhbGciOiJIUzI1NiIsInR5cCI6IkpXVCJ9.eyJzdWIiOiI0Z4ywpUMsBIn0.ca5FVhkdBXa3